What makes Fresno different
Fresno’s summers are long and warm, with triple-digit days stacked throughout July and August. Winter nights are cool, usually dropping into the 30s. Our diurnal swings are real. That places power functionality on the midsection of any window determination. Title 24 (California’s potential code) units the floor for potency, and your HOA most often references it, yet remedy and bills are what you feel day after day. The suitable glass kit can drop indoor temperatures by using numerous tiers on a summer season afternoon. I have measured as so much as a 6 to 8 diploma distinction in rooms that swapped builder-grade unmarried panes for low-E double panes with a sun warmth gain coefficient beneath zero.25.
Stucco dominates Fresno exteriors, highly in mid-2000s subdivisions. That topics for the reason that a full-frame substitute potential cutting stucco and patching, which a few HOAs dislike with the aid of shade matching and prospective cracking. Retrofit inserts, the place the brand new body slips into the antique one, prevent stucco patches and regularly cross architectural assessment more smoothly. Both tools have their position, and the HOA’s architectural criteria customarily steer you in the direction of one or the other.
Noise is the sleeper factor in assured tracts near 41, 168, or best arterials like Herndon. If you might be near to a school or a busy intersection, laminated glass could make a larger big difference than you believe you studied. HOAs seldom specify acoustic overall performance, yet they do care that the outside seem to be remains constant. That provides you freedom to go with quieter glass inner a compliant frame.
How HOA approvals particularly work
Most Fresno HOAs run approvals thru an Architectural Review Committee. The committee’s activity is to stay the nearby’s appearance coherent and defend property values. They usually are not attempting to make your lifestyles tough, besides the fact that it feels that means when they ask for window minimize sheets and coloration chips. The committee most commonly meets per 30 days. Some higher institutions meet two times a month, but I plan around a 4 to 6 week cycle from submission to approval as a result of resubmittals are hassle-free.
The ideas you'll be able to face fall into 3 buckets. First, shade and end. If your neighborhood has vinyl home windows in almond or tan, do not plan on switching the exterior to black with out a communication. Second, grille styles and sightlines. If half the road has colonial grids at the the front elevation, the committee will in all likelihood choose you to tournament it even if you decide on a clean, no-grid seem. Third, install technique. Some CC&Rs explicitly ban nail-fin installs without board approval through the stucco cuts. Others require tempered glass in distinct places, aligning with code.
Expect the utility to ask for a plot plan or no less than a marked image showing each and every commencing you intend to replace. Expect to offer product info sheets with U-ingredient and SHGC values, external colour samples, and a remark about how the install shall be done. The extra you the front-load, the smoother it is going. I have visible initiatives sail using in a unmarried meeting due to the fact the bundle answered questions the committee did now not have got to ask.
A Fresno-savvy plan that HOAs like
When I take a Fresno house owner from principle to put in home windows with HOA approval, I degree the assignment in a method that matches the valley’s calendar and the HOA’s rhythm. Early spring and early fall are golden windows for equally alleviation and scheduling. Summer installs are viable, yet crews stream faster in May than in August while frames are scorching enough to fry an egg.
We leap with a highway-facing audit. Walk the block and be aware what has already been permitted on similar residences. If four friends changed with tan vinyl sliders that saved white interior frames and colonial grids on the the front purely, that could be a de facto favourite. It is easier to get definite whilst you'll be able to element to precedence with pix.
Next, we settle on a product line that hits Title 24 numbers, affords the HOA’s fashionable external shade, and has a sparkling, steady profile. In Fresno, I prefer low-E glass tuned to shrink solar benefit, now not just a average low-E. Many brands present glass applications with SHGC around 0.22 to 0.28 and U-explanations among 0.26 and 0.30 in dual-pane configurations. If your house faces west onto a pool or patio, that SHGC is your loved one.
Then we come to a decision an set up procedure. Retrofits are quicker and produce less mess, an HOA crowd pleaser. Full-frame alternative restores the original glass section and may restore long-term water or dry-rot problems. If the HOA dislikes stucco cuts, I offer a retrofit plan with photos of achieved installs on equivalent properties, concentrating on how the outside trim appears. If the home has water intrusion heritage or critically rotted frames, I bring together evidence and request full-frame with a stucco patch plan and a paint schedule. Committees are more flexible when they be aware the need.
Finally, I construct a submission packet that looks as if it got here from a seasoned, now not a bet. You do now not desire to be a dressmaker. You simply want to expose the committee precisely what they may be approving.
What to put in your HOA submission packet
The most beneficial packets answer questions ahead of the committee asks them. Here is a uncomplicated structure that works throughout most Fresno HOAs:
A disguise page with your tackle, scope of labor, and a checklist of window destinations through elevation, not simply room title. Labeled portraits of each elevation, with windows numbered to match a schedule. A window schedule desk with dimension, category, glass package deal, grid trend, and tempered or now not, tied to code-required locations. Manufacturer files sheets exhibiting exterior shade, body materials, U-component and SHGC, and any acoustic or laminated concepts if proposed. A one-web page installing description, such as retrofit vs full-body, sealants, flashing attitude, and whether stucco can be cut or painted.
Keep it sparkling and legible. Black text on white paper. If your HOA accepts digital submissions, integrate every part right into a unmarried PDF. If you advise black outdoors frames on a beige-stucco network, embody a snapshot of a similar domicile in the regional or the builder’s later part that used darker frames. Precedent is persuasive.
Reading the CC&Rs without falling asleep
CC&Rs are dense, however you only want a couple of pages. Search for architectural management, outside variations, fenestration, and color specifications. Look for language about “obvious from the street” requisites. Many HOAs are stricter on front and aspects obvious from the street, and more lenient on rear elevations. That opens negotiating room. Also look for noise ordinances and paintings hours. Fresno town rules and your HOA’s regulations would the two restrict weekday and weekend work get started times. Crews can bounce as early as 7 a.m. under metropolis code in lots of zones, however some HOAs push to 8 a.m. for courtesy. Note the ones on your application and on your installer contract. Telling the committee one can stick to HOA paintings hours indicators admire and reduces pushback.
Color, end, and fashion offerings that pass
I even have noticed beautiful black exterior windows get rejected on first bypass, then authorised with minor tweaks. The trick is to suit the HOA’s vocabulary. Many institutions opt for “earth tones” and “harmonious finishes.” In observe, which means these directions tend to bypass:
Match or harmonize with the prevailing trim. In tan-stucco neighborhoods, almond, tan, or bronze-toned frames by and large clean. Jet-black can bypass while paired with darker roofs or modern-day elevations, yet you can also desire to supply a mockup or producer image on similar stucco. Keep the front elevation constant with the common builder cause. If the unique had divided lite styles at the top sash, providing simulated divided lites solely on the street side can satisfy aesthetics at the same time preserving the outdoor open. Choose low-profile frames that stay away from bulky retrofit flanges on the face. Some retrofit frames have a thick outside edge that reads like a photograph frame. HOAs with an eye fixed for authentic builder traces choose slimmer profiles. A suitable installer can tutor you options.
Vinyl dominates in replacement thanks to expense and functionality, and so much HOAs settle for it. If your community turned into constructed with aluminum frames and wants to sustain a thin sightline, check out aluminum-clad or fiberglass. They payment more, but the profile should be would becould very well be worth the upcharge for entrance-dealing with home windows. I actually have break up projects where the entrance elevation used fiberglass for the look, and the perimeters and rear used vinyl to manage finances. As long as the colours in shape, the combo passes the sidewalk test.
Balancing code, convenience, and HOA constraints
California calories code requires confident functionality numbers stylish on weather zone. Fresno sits in a area that pushes you closer to low U-elements and lessen SHGC. That works in your choose. If the HOA wants to see numbers on paper, demonstrate the glass kit that beats code via a margin. Committees like the phrase “meets or exceeds Title 24.” It indications diligence.
For safety glazing, the California Residential Code requires tempered glass close to doors, in greater panels close to jogging surfaces, and in lavatories close tubs or showers. Your installer may still capture these instantly, but HOAs oftentimes require you to call it out inside the time table. It does now not hurt to underline safety locations on your submission. Retrofit or full-frame: what the committee wants to know
Retrofit insert home windows depart the present frame in position and construct the recent unit within it. You lose a bit of glass side, more often than not 1 to one.five inches consistent with facet, yet you steer clear of stucco slicing. Full-frame alternative gets rid of the previous frame, exposes the tough opening, and installs a nail-fin window with new flashing. It restores glass location and addresses hidden spoil however calls for stucco or trim work.
HOAs probably prefer retrofits because they're low have an effect on and predictable. When I want full-frame, I gift a hassle-free structure plan:
A notice that stucco cuts should be instantly, with control joints revered, and that cracks will probably be patched with like-for-like finish. A paint plan that suits the current coloration with the aid of brand and code, or incorporates a full elevation repaint for consistency if the sun shades will not combo. A flashing aspect description, resembling self-adhered flashing tape on the sill and jamb, returned dams, and a suitable sealant.
That language is absolutely not overkill. It communicates that you are going to no longer go away scars. If there may be known water intrusion, a letter from a contractor describing the drawback provides the committee cowl to approve a greater invasive method.
Timelines, inspections, and holding momentum
From first check with to set up windows, a soft HOA project in Fresno runs eight to 12 weeks. The variable is committee cadence and whether you desire a resubmittal. Here is a sensible arc I see many times:
Week 1 to 2: Site discuss with, product alternative, photographs, and HOA packet well prepared. Week three: Submit packet earlier than the committee deadline. Week four to five: Committee evaluate. If they want tweaks, you respond that week. Week 6 to 7: Approval letter issued. Order home windows. Week eight to ten: Factory lead times. Vinyl is typically 3 to 5 weeks, fiberglass can run 6 to eight. Week eleven to 12: Installation and ultimate walkthrough.
City permits for like-for-like replacement in Fresno are on a regular basis simple. Many window replacements do not require structural allows for if you happen to should not altering establishing sizes, yet Title 24 compliance office work and HERS checking out can come into play for sure scope. A pro installer will recognize while a let is required. If the HOA desires proof, ask your contractor for the enable variety or a letter stating why no allow is needed for the scope. Providing that prematurely stops the “is that this authorised?” loop.
How to deal with denials and partial approvals
Denials usually are not the conclusion. The most customary motives I see:
The outdoors coloration is just too darkish for the network palette. Offer a bronze or deep taupe external rather then pure black on the front and sides, store black at the rear if allowed. Or put up a photo set of authorised black frames inside the related tract.
The grille pattern does now not healthy. Add grids to the road elevation handiest. On a two-tale, typically the committee wants grids on higher home windows to secure rhythm, while permitting no grids on lessen sliders. Offer that compromise.
The committee dislikes stucco cuts. Pivot to retrofit on side road elevations and hold complete-frame at the rear wherein not visible, or suggest a professional stucco finisher with a pattern of texture and a repaint of affected elevations.
Respond inside of every week, store your tone friendly, and thank the committee for suggestions. It sets a collaborative tone and strikes you to a higher time table speedily.
The contractor’s function in HOA success
Not each and every installer desires to combat with HOA documents. Choose one who does. Ask for snap shots of past HOA-accepted initiatives in Fresno or Clovis. Ask how they report glass efficiency and installing information. A contractor who can hand you a clean packet template, product lower sheets, and coloration samples is really worth greater than the bottom bid.
Scheduling subjects too. Window crews operating in July afternoons on a west-facing elevation can war, which translates to sloppy sealant or rushed trim. I attempt to schedule the front elevations inside the morning and coloration paintings in the afternoon. If the HOA has quiet hours, construct the ones into the day plan. Let your instant buddies realize the agenda. A courtesy observe avoids proceedings that to find their approach to the committee.
Cases from the field
A homeowner in a gated northeast Fresno building sought after black outdoors home windows on a Spanish-taste stucco residence. The CC&Rs leaned toward hot earth tones. We submitted two options: black on the rear and bronze on the road-going through elevations, and a 2nd choice with all bronze. We blanketed images of comparable bronze installs on the same street. The committee accredited the combined plan with a be aware requiring grids on both the front arched windows to sustain individual. The house owner got the refreshing rear yard view they wanted, and the the front saved the neighborhood’s visual rhythm.
In northwest Fresno near a busy connector, site visitors noise made evenings harsh. The HOA had no sound regulation, only a shade palette and a grill pattern at the the front. We proposed laminated glass on both the front bedrooms and the part going through the street, a substitute invisible outdoor. That small collection dropped interior evening noise quite. The committee did not even touch upon it, in view that the outside matched flawlessly.
A 1990s tract in vital Fresno had substantial dry rot underneath previous aluminum frames. The HOA disliked stucco cuts yet commonly used complete-frame replacements if we repainted full elevations. We documented the rot with pics and additional a line item to repaint each one elevation after stucco patches. Approval came in a unmarried assembly. Costs rose by way of approximately 12 to 18 p.c. when put next to retrofits, however the homeowner not involved approximately hidden ruin or water.
Budget, rebates, and value
Window quotes range with drapery, dimension, glass choices, and set up kind. In Fresno, retrofit vinyl home windows most often fall into a spread that continues a median unmarried-kinfolk domestic challenge among mid four figures and the teens, based on be counted and gains. Full-body or fiberglass can push higher. Acoustic laminates add approximately several hundred greenbacks consistent with opening, normally much less on smaller windows.
California application rebates for excessive-functionality home windows modification yr to year. Programs on the whole require specified U-issue and SHGC thresholds and might package deal with complete-area strength improvements. If a rebate exists, the HOA will no longer item to you taking it, however they will ask for affirmation that exterior appearance stays compliant. Ask your installer to compare latest PG&E or statewide programs until now you order, not after. Rebate office work is less demanding to organize should you recognize the goal efficiency at the spec level.
Value displays up speedy in Fresno summers. Air conditioners cycle much less, west rooms live usable in late afternoon, and furnishings stops fading as swift. I actually have had shoppers call two weeks after deploy to say they set the thermostat two degrees greater and felt as tender as ahead of.
